How to Sign a PDF Online: A Simple Step-by-Step Guide

Learn how to add an electronic signature to a PDF online, check the finished document, and share it with confidence.

Quick answer

How can I sign a PDF online without printing it?

Upload the final PDF to the Sign PDF tool, create or upload your signature, place it in the correct field, add the date if required, and download the completed copy. Reopen the downloaded PDF and check every signed page before sending it.

Printing a document just to sign it wastes paper and time. An online PDF signing tool lets you add a signature from a laptop, tablet, or phone, then download a clean copy that is ready to send. This approach works well for permission forms, invoices, agreements, approval sheets, and other everyday documents.

What you need before you sign

Start with the final version of the PDF. Read every page and confirm that names, dates, totals, and terms are correct. If the document still needs changes, make them first with the Edit PDF Online tool. Signing the finished version prevents confusion about which copy was approved.

How to add a signature to a PDF

  1. Open the Sign PDF tool and choose the document from your device.
  2. Create or upload your signature using the options shown in the editor.
  3. Place the signature in the correct field and resize it so it fits naturally.
  4. Add the signing date or any requested initials.
  5. Preview every page, apply the changes, and download the signed PDF.

Keep the original unsigned file until the recipient confirms that the signed copy is accepted. A clear filename such as service-agreement-signed-2026.pdf also makes the document easier to identify later.

Check the PDF before sending it

Open the downloaded file rather than relying only on the editing preview. Make sure the signature is visible, nothing covers the surrounding text, and all pages are present. If the file is too large for an email attachment, use Compress PDF and check the compressed copy once more.

Electronic signatures and sensitive documents

Different organizations and jurisdictions may have specific rules for electronic signatures. Ask the recipient whether a standard electronic signature is acceptable when the document involves regulated, legal, financial, or identity-sensitive information. Use a device and network you trust, and avoid leaving confidential downloads on a shared computer.

Frequently asked questions

Can I sign a PDF on my phone?

Yes. A mobile browser can be convenient for drawing a signature with a finger or stylus. Zoom in before placing it so the result stays inside the signature box.

Should I flatten the signed PDF?

Flattening can help keep visual marks in place, but it may also limit later editing. Follow the recipient's instructions and always preserve an original copy.
